Unregistered but notary attested existing gpa

(Querist) 05 October 2015 This query is : Resolved 
I am looking to buy a property in delhi. The property is having recent existing GPA done in 2015 which is not registered with sub registrar but notary attested. Now can i register the GPA at the time of buying it.

kavksatyanarayana Online (Expert) 06 October 2015
@author, The notary attested GPA is only for evidence. Where no Sub Registrar office is exist then only notary attest document is valid.But for registration of further transactions, the GPA shall be registered if the SRO exists in the place where the principal is residing.
Dr J C Vashista (Expert) 08 October 2015
Check with concerned sub-registrar whether the Khasra number mentioned therein the GPA (under sale/purchase)can be registered.
Prefer a property where SALE DEED is being transacted and registered since the GPA do not transfer title of property, especially after the Supreme Court judgment in Surya Roshini case.
